Question/Problem Description
What is the  install command for installing Progress/ OpenEdge on a UNIX machine?
What is Service Pack install command for UNIX?
What is the name of the command used when installing OpenEdge on a UNIX platform?
How to Install Progress/ OpenEdge on a UNIX machine?

Resolution
The command is proinst.  This command resides in the directory where the Progress/OpenEdge installation was downloaded and expanded.

Example:  
 
./<directory name where the FCS (First Customer Ship) or Service Pack was expanded>/proinst
 
i.e.

/SP10.1B03_CD_IMAGE/proinst
